![]() I am looking for feedback from those of you who have larger systems on what your water change schedule is like. On my 150g I used to do biweekly 15% WC. I also did his based on a heavy bioload and high nutrients. I am just wondering what folks with lager tanks are doing for WC.
Biweekly or monthly and how much percent of the system are you changing during these? Appreciate any feedback.
